Snack makers who allegedly made and sold "dujjonku" and other internet-viral sweets without proper business registration have been referred to prosecutors.
Four individuals and one company were charged with violating the Food Sanitation Act after the Ministry of Food and Drug Safety launched an investigation following information that two popular desserts — the Dubai-style chewy cookie, known as dujjonku, and Shanghai Butter
tteok (rice cake) — were being manufactured and distributed illegally in Gyeonggi.
